TRANSMISSION SERVICE
Transmission Removal
1. Position the vehicle on a level surface.
2. Remove the seat and side panels (see Chapter 9).
3. Disconnect the negative (-) battery cable (see Chapter 2).
4. Remove the rear cab and footwells (see Chapter 9).
5. Thoroughly clean the engine, transmission and chassis.
6. Drain the transmission fluid (see Chapter 2).
7. Remove the left rear wheel, lower left-hand frame support
and outer PVT cover (see Chapter 7 “DRIVE BELT - Belt
Removal”).
8. Remove the PVT intake duct from the transmission, and the
PVT outlet duct from the inner PVT cover (see Chapter 7).
9. Remove the (4) bolts retaining the rear propshaft to the rear
gearcase input shaft. Slide the shaft off the transmission
output shaft and out from the vehicle.
10. Disconnect the wheel speed sensor located on the lower
right-hand side of the transmission.
11. Disconnect the gear selector switch from the top of the
transmission.
12. Disconnect the linkage rod from the gear selector.
13. Remove the high tension leads from the engine and remove
the (2) nuts from each exhaust flange at the engine.
14. Remove the exhaust springs retaining the exhaust pipe to
the silencer and remove the pipe from the vehicle.
15. Remove the (7) bolts retaining the transmission to the
engine.
16. Remove the (2) vent lines from the top left portion of the
transmission.
17. Remove the lower right airbox retaining screw.
